=head1 NAME
WebService::Scaleway - Perl interface to Scaleway cloud server provider API
=head1 SYNOPSIS
use WebService::Scaleway;
my $token = ...; # API token here
my $sw = WebService::Scaleway->new($token);
my $org = $sw->organizations;
# Create an IP, a volume, and use them for a new Debian Jessie server
my $ip = $sw->create_ip($org);
my $vol = $sw->create_volume('testvol', $org, 'l_ssd', 50_000_000_000);
my ($debian) = grep { $_->name =~ /debian jessie/i } $sw->images;
my $srv = $sw->create_server('testsrv', $org, $debian, {1 => $vol->id});
# Now we have a server, an IP, and two volumes (the root volume with
# Debian Jessie, and the extra volume we just created).
# Change the server name
$srv->{name} = 'Debian';
$sw->update_server($srv);
# Boot the server
$sw->perform_server_action($srv, 'poweron');
say "The server is now booting. To access it, do ssh root@", $ip->address;
=head1 DESCRIPTION
Scaleway is an IaaS provider that offers bare metal ARM cloud servers.
WebService::Scaleway is a Perl interface to the Scaleway API.
=head2 Constructors
WebService::Scaleway objects are defined by their authentication
token. There are two consructors:
=over
=item WebService::Scaleway->B<new>(I<$auth_token>)
Construct a WebService::Scaleway object from a given authentication
token.
=item WebService::Scaleway->B<new>(I<$email>, I<$password>)
Construct a WebService::Scaleway object from an authentication token
obtained by logging in with the given credentials.
=back
=head2 Listing resources
These methods return a list of all resources of a given type
associated to your account. Each resource is a blessed hashref with
C<AUTOLOAD>ed accessors (for example C<< $resource->{name} >> can be
written as C<< $resource->name >>) and that stringifies to the ID of
the resource: C<< $resource->id >>.
There is no difference between B<resources>() and
B<list_resources>().

=head2 Retrieving resources
These methods take the ID of a resource and return the resource as a
blessed hashref as described in the previous section.
You can pass a blessed hashref instead of a resource ID, and you'll
get a fresh version of the object passed. Useful if something updated
the object in the meantime.
There is no difference between B<resource>(I<$id>) and
B<get_resource>(I<$id>).

=head2 Deleting resources
These methods take the ID of a resource and delete it. They do not
return anything. You can pass a blessed hashref instead of a resource
ID.

=head2 Modifying resources
These methods take a hashref representing a resource that already
exists and update it. The value of C<< $resource->{id} >> is used for
identifying this resource on the remote end. Both blessed and
unblessed hashrefs are accepted. The updated resource is returned as a
blessed hashref as described in L</"Listing resources">.

=head2 Creating resources
These methods take either a hash that is passed directly to the API or
a method-specific list of positional parameters. They create a new
resource and return it as a blessed hashref as described in
L</"Listing resources">.
When using positional parameters, you can pass a resource in blessed
hashref format where a resource ID is expected, unless the method's
documentation says otherwise.
Most of these methods require an organization ID. You can obtain it
with the B<organizations> method described above.
=over
=item $self->B<create_token>(I<\%data>)
=item $self->B<create_token>(I<$email>, I<$password>, [I<$expires>])
Authenticates a user against their username and password and returns
an authentication token. If I<$expires> (default: false) is true, the
token will expire.
This method is called internally by the two-argument constructor.
Official documentation: L<https://developer.scaleway.com/#tokens-tokens-get>.
=item $self->B<create_server>(I<\%data>)
=item $self->B<create_server>(I<$name>, I<$organization>, I<$image>, I<$volumes>, [I<$tags>])
Creates and returns a new server.
I<$name> is the server name. I<$organization> is the organization ID.
I<$image> is the image ID. I<$volumes> is a "sparse array" (hashref
from indexes to volume IDs, indexed from 1) of B<extra> volumes (that
is, volumes other than the root volume). I<$tags> is an optional
arrayref of tags.
For the I<$volumes> parameter you can pass hashrefs that describe
volumes instead of volume IDs. This will create new volumes. The
hashrefs are (presumably) passed to B<create_volume>. An example
inspired by the official documentation:
$volumes = { 1 => {
name => "vol_demo",
organization => "ecc1c86a-eabb-43a7-9c0a-77e371753c0a",
size => 10_000_000_000,
volume_type => "l_sdd",
}};
Note that there B<may not> be any blessed hashrefs inside I<$volumes>.
Official documentation: L<https://developer.scaleway.com/#servers-servers-get>.
=item $self->B<create_volume>(I<\%data>)
=item $self->B<create_volume>(I<$name>, I<$organization>, I<$volume_type>, I<$size>)
Creates and returns a new volume. I<$volume_type> currently must be
C<l_ssd>. I<$size> is the size in bytes.
Official documentation: L<https://developer.scaleway.com/#volumes-volumes-get>.
=item $self->B<create_snapshot>(I<\%data>)
=item $self->B<create_snapshot>(I<$name>, I<$organization>, I<$volume_id>)
Creates and returns a snapshot of the volume I<$volume_id>.
Official documentation: L<https://developer.scaleway.com/#snapshots-snapshots-get>.
=item $self->B<create_image>(I<\%data>)
=item $self->B<create_image>(I<$name>, I<$organization>, I<$root_volume>, I<$arch>)
Creates and returns an image from the volume I<$root_volume>. I<$arch>
is the architecture of the image (currently must be C<"arm">).
Official documentation: L<https://developer.scaleway.com/#images-images-get>.

=head2 Miscellaneous methods
These are methods that don't fit any previous category. Any use of
"blessed hashref" refers to the concept described in L</"Listing
resources">. Wherever a resource ID is expected, you can instead pass
a resource as a blessed hashref and the method will call C<< ->id >>
on it for you.
=over
=item $self->B<server_actions>(I<$server_id>)
=item $self->B<list_server_actions>(I<$server_id>)
Returns a list of strings representing possible actions you can
perform on the given server. Example actions are powering on/off a
server or rebooting it.
Official documentation: L<https://developer.scaleway.com/#servers-actions-get>
=item $self->B<perform_server_action>(I<$server_id>, I<$action>)
Performs an action on a server. I<$action> is one of the strings
returned by B<server_actions>. The function returns a blessed hashref
with information about the task.
This is not very useful, as this module does not currently offer any
function for tracking tasks.
Official documentation: L<https://developer.scaleway.com/#servers-actions-post>
=item $self->B<refresh_token>(I<$token_id>)
This method takes the ID of an expirable token, extends its expiration
date by 30 minutes, and returns the new token as a blessed hashref.
Official documentation: L<https://developer.scaleway.com/#tokens-token-patch>
=item $self->B<server_metadata>
This method can only be called from a Scaleway server. It returns
information about the server as a blessed hashref.
Official documentation: L<https://developer.scaleway.com/#metadata-c1-server-metadata>
